The chief difference between the two is that a waveguide confines the electromagnetic field to an area along the path, while an antenna radiates the electromagnetic field into space. ![]() Microwave signals are transmitted from location-to-location by waveguides or antennas. This article describes some useful transmission lines and the problems they solve. Having a variety of transmission lines in your tool kit can get you out of trouble in tricky situations. The most commonly used transmission lines (stripline and microstrip line) aren't the only way to transmit a signal from one place to another.
